Ordination of newly-elected Metropolitan of Mexico at the Phanar (VIDEO+PHOTOS) (upd)

LAST UPDATE: 13:21, 3/2/2024

On Friday, February 2, 2024, the feast of the Presentation of the Lord, the ordination of the elected Metropolitan Iakovos of Mexico as Bishop took place at the Phanar.

Ecumenical Patriarch Bartholomew presided over the Divine Liturgy with the participation of Metropolitan Elder Apostolos of Derkoi, Metropolitans Ignatio of Dimitrias and Almyros, Eirinaios of Myriophytos and Peristasis, Nektarios of Anthidonos, Maximos of Selyvria, Andreas of Saranta Ekklisies, and Theodoros of Seleucia.

The Ecumenical Patriarch provided guidance and encouragement to the newly ordained Bishop for the mission and ministry entrusted to him by the Mother Church.

“Your extensive theological and secular education, linguistic proficiency, diligence, organizational and administrative capabilities, dynamism, and fervor in carrying out your sacred duties, along with other virtues, make you deserving of elevation to the esteemed hierarchical position. In a short while, you will receive the fullness of priestly grace through the laying on of hands by our Mediocrity and the co-officiating hierarchs. We extend our congratulations on this significant honor bestowed by the Mother Church. May the Lord continuously fortify the Church, ensuring that, as a Bishop, you uphold the admirable character of a humble and virtuous clergyman. May you also fulfill the hopeful expectations with which the Mother Church dispatches you as a new Hierarch to labor in the vineyard of the American continent

To the devout Christians, our spiritual children in Central America, where you are headed from today, communicate with them in their language about the sacredness of the Ecumenical Throne and its significance—this grand entity and name. Discuss its ecumenical nature, the expansiveness of its vision, its radiance extending everywhere, and the respect and honor it commands.

Among his paternal words, the Ecumenical Patriarch said: “Proclaim, therefore, the ideals for which the Holy Great Church of Christ stands as the carrier and exponent. Share the message that our faithful can take pride in belonging to such a Church—an institution that, for centuries from its blessed and sanctified seat, continues to nourish Orthodox believers everywhere with the divine manna, ‘the sweetener of pious senses.’

To nourish them and not exhaust this manna, ‘which is always consumed and never spent, but those who participate,’ supporting and consolidating the Orthodox faith, patience, hope, and love. Indeed, to love, Your Grace, holy brother, as our Lord Jesus Christ taught us—to nourish and extend that love not only to our friends but also to our enemies and those who persecute us: ‘Bless those who persecute you; bless and do not curse them!”

Concluding his speech, the Ecumenical Patriarch blessed and congratulated the parents of the Bishop, “who willingly offered their child to the Church to become a deacon of the Church and the faithful people of God.”

The Patriarch made a special reference to the spiritual father of the elected Metropolitan, Archbishop Ieronymos of Athens and All Greece. Despite his desire to be present, Archbishop Ieronymos could not attend the ordination of Iakovos as Bishop. He was represented by a three-member delegation led by Metropolitan Ignatios of Dimitrias and Almyros, whom the Patriarch welcomed and thanked for their participation in the co-liturgy. The delegation also included Archimandrite Ioannis Karamouzis, the new Chief Secretary of the Holy Synod of the Church of Greece.

Metropolitan Stefanos of Kallioupolis and Madytos, Bishops Adrianos of Halicarnassus, Smaragdos of Dafnouasia, and Paisios of Xanthoupolis, clergymen, Archons of the Great Church of Christ, the US Ambassador to Greece, Georgios Tsounis, the Deputy Head of Mission of the Embassy of Mexico in Greece Edgar Cubero Gómez, the General Secretary of Public Property of the Ministry of National Economy and Finance of Greece, Nagia Kollia, the parents and relatives of the new Metropolitan, who traveled from the USA, believers from Constantinople, and pilgrims from Greece and abroad.

Following the service, in the packed Throne Room at the Patriarchal House, the newly appointed Metropolitan conveyed his gratitude to the Ecumenical Patriarch and the members of the Holy Synod for his election. Additionally, he expressed thanks to Archbishop Ieronymos of Athens and All Greece for the paternal love and support extended to him until today.

Subsequently, the Ecumenical Patriarch conveyed his joy for the ordination of the Metropolitan of Mexico. He also expressed gratitude to the Greek-American Ambassador of the USA to Greece, Tsounis, for attending the event. The Ecumenical Patriarch received Ambassador Tsounis and his spouse Olga at the Patriarchal Office shortly thereafter. Metropolitan Ignatios of Dimitrias and Almyros conveyed the joy of the Church of Greece, expressing warm and cordial sentiments about the new Hierarch of the Ecumenical Throne.
